Welcome to the Brindlemoor plugin program. If you're investigating cron drift on the Oakhollow scheduler, note that job timestamps are recorded in the coordinator's local zone, not UTC, so apparent drift under 90 seconds is usually a display artifact. Full traces live in the sealed diagnostics bundle, which external authors may open using the recovery passphrase provided below.

vault phrase of bajof-tafop = alddor-zordor-holiel-briix-tamath-fraath-ulavan-rusix-kelox-ulair

During October, Ketteridge House is migrating from the old SwipePoint badges to the new Accessa readers. Team assistants should collect replacement badges for their teams from facilities on level 1 and return old ones in the marked bins. Until migration completes, some internal doors will fall back to keypad entry. Those fallback keypads accept the interim code below.

door code, kawip-bagap: bdg-HQEWH-4

We walked through the rounding discrepancy reports: conversions between low-denomination currencies can drift by one minor unit when amounts pass through the intermediate settlement layer. The fix standardizes on half-even rounding at a single point, removing the double-round. Support should tell affected customers that historical statements will be corrected automatically over the next billing cycle; no action is needed on their end. Customer escalations should reference the owner named below.

account owner for bawip-tahag: Raleth Quenok

Changed defaults in Splitfork, our assignment service. Bucketing now uses sticky hashing per account instead of per session, and the holdout slice grew from 2% to 5%. Callers relying on session-level reassignment must opt in explicitly. Review the diff against the new baseline; the updated default configuration is listed below.

config for tagep-kajof:
[casir]
port = 6379
region = south-1
host = casir.paliqdyn.example
team = tamax
timeout_ms = 250
retries = 2